Allow using upper and lower case true|false when setting kubectl feature flags #121441

What this PR does / why we need it:

I've noticed this while reviewing #120663, this allows reading feature flag value respectively of case.

Does this PR introduce a user-facing change?

Allow using lower and upper case feature flag value, the name has to match still
